| HOUSE RESOLUTION
| 2 |
| WHEREAS, John T. Trutter has been called to eternal life by | 3 |
| the wisdom of God at the age of 86; and
| 4 |
| WHEREAS, John T. Trutter was a widely respected business | 5 |
| executive who hailed from a prominent Springfield family; and
| 6 |
| WHEREAS, John T. Trutter spent his career with the Illinois | 7 |
| Bell Telephone Company, holding positions in numerous facets | 8 |
| with the company before retiring as Senior Vice President for | 9 |
| Community Affairs and Public Relations; and
| 10 |
| WHEREAS, Known as a gifted organizer and natural leader, | 11 |
| John T. Trutter received his bachelor's degree from the | 12 |
| University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ign, where he was the | 13 |
| Student Body President; and
| 14 |
| WHEREAS, John T. Trutter achieved the rank of Lieutenant | 15 |
| Colonel in the United States Army and received the Legion of | 16 |
| Merit Award for his dedicated service during World War II; and | 17 |
| WHEREAS, An active member with numerous civic and | 18 |
| charitable organizations, John T. Trutter served on the Board | 19 |
| of the United Cerebral Palsy Association of Greater Chicago, | 20 |
| and for several years was its President and Chairman; and

| WHEREAS, During the 1980's, John T. Trutter was the | 2 |
| President and Chief Executive Officer of the Chicago Convention | 3 |
| and Tourism Bureau and President of the Chicago Tourism | 4 |
| Council; and | 5 |
| WHEREAS, From 1986 until 2002, John T. Trutter was | 6 |
| Chancellor of the Lincoln Academy, which honors Illinois | 7 |
| residents for their contributions in diverse areas such as | 8 |
| business, science, and the arts; and
| 9 |
| WHEREAS, For his tireless efforts and distinguished work in | 10 |
| the social services, John T. Trutter was awarded the Order of | 11 |
| Lincoln by Governor James Thompson, the State of Illinois' | 12 |
| highest honor; and
